What types of orthodontic needs can Invisalign treat?
Invisalign technology is very effective for treating mild to moderate tooth crowding or spacing issues, including gaps between teeth, overlapping teeth, protruding teeth—even an underbite or overbite.
How does Invisalign work?
Invisalign treatment consists of wearing a series of clear aligning trays that fit over your upper and lower teeth. Based on your treatment plan and a 3D model of your mouth, a computer generates the custom trays that you will change out about every two weeks. Each successive set of trays will gently move your teeth more along the ideal tooth migration path. As your teeth move, you will see a gradual improvement in your smile and more ideal tooth relationships.
Why do patients love Invisalign?
Although you are likely to experience some tenderness and tingling after each new aligner is inserted, due to tooth movement, you will be more comfortable than wearing traditional braces because the aligners are smooth and will not irritate the soft tissue of your mouth. Patients find they get used to wearing their trays and speaking normally within a few hours of inserting each new tray. Because wearers remove the trays each time they eat and clean their teeth, they can enjoy any foods and are more able to thoroughly clean their mouths. Because Invisalign aligners are clear, many times, others won’t even know patients are wearing them. And, best of all, patients love the results of an attractive and healthy smile!

Why are 1 in 5 Invisalign patients adults?
Many adults, who would have benefited from braces when they were young but were unable or unwilling to wear braces then, do not want to wear traditional braces in their adult years. Invisalign technology allows them to live a normal adult life while straightening their teeth. In addition, adults who did undergo orthodontics previously, may be experiencing tooth movement or relapse, and Invisalign is an easy way to treat such conditions. Overall, adults appreciate the convenience and flexibility this treatment affords, and they are grateful for this opportunity to have an esthetic, more youthful smile and healthier mouth.
How does Invisalign make a mouth healthier?
Proper alignment of teeth is essential for best biting function and minimal wear on opposing teeth. Misaligned teeth may increase the incidence of grinding and/or clenching, possibly resulting in jaw pain, cracked or broken teeth, and worn tooth surfaces. Proper spacing not only makes it easier to eat, but also improves oral hygiene by relieving overcrowding. When teeth are crowded, it is more difficult for toothbrush bristles to reach around all tooth surfaces, which increases plaque and calculus build up. Plaque and calculus increase a patient’s risk for developing cavities and gum disease. Straight teeth result in healthier gums, and cleaner longer-lasting teeth and dental restorations.
